Full House works in 4 strategic areas;1. Quality Work (Making)2. Developing Audiences (Watching)3. Participation (Doing)4. Advocacy (Sharing)The 4 areas are often intrinsically linked but can also be delivered independently of each other. The interlocking strands of work are focused on making a difference to children's lives, playing our part to help children to become great grown ups.

How much income did Full House Theatre report in 2025?

Full House Theatre reported total income of £602k and reported expenditure of £517k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

When was Full House Theatre registered as a charity?

Full House Theatre was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 11 February 2016 as charity number 1165541. It has been registered for 10 years.

Who runs Full House Theatre?

Full House Theatre is governed by a board of 6 trustees.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does Full House Theatre operate?

Full House Theatre operates in England,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.

Is Full House Theatre a registered charity?

Yes — Full House Theatre is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 1165541.
